Dazed and Confused (1993)

Richard Linklater's comedy drama about the last day of school in a Texas town.

Dazed and Confused is one of those rare films that seems to improve with each viewing. Perhaps it's the brilliant cast of likable characters or perhaps it's the 70's rock n' roll soundtrack which features everyone from Alice Cooper to ZZ Top, Lynyrd Skynyrd to Bob Dylan and Foghat to Black Sabbath.

Set in 1976 it's a beautifully written film, both funny and poignant with a brilliantly assembled cast of characters including Ben Affleck as a bullying high school jock who failed to graduate the first time, to Matthew McConaughey's twenty something who likes to hang out with high school students. The film focuses on, well everyone really. From the geeks to the freaks, all have a starring role in the film and it's testament to Linklater that everyone feels rounded and no one is left out.

Laugh out loud funny, sad, outrageous and occasionally dreamlike, Linklater puts everything into the film giving it a quality that makes you want to be there. You want to play high school pranks, you want to party, drink and smoke weed and you definitely want to join Joey Lauren Adams and co in going to that Aerosmith concert as the end credits roll.
